Azuki Co., Ltd. is the company behind the absorbent shorts brand 'PlayS' tailored for athletes. The company is committed to developing high-performance absorbent shorts suitable for everyone from athletes to children, with a strong focus on addressing the menstruation-related problems of female athletes.
Beyond product development, Azuki Co., Ltd. has been actively hosting seminars and leading initiatives to encourage the widespread adoption of its absorbent shorts. This time, we spoke to representative Daisuke Sakagami about his mission.

Absorbent Shorts Born out of TV Production
Tell us about why your company turned its focus into absorbent shorts.
We established the company in 2013, and initially, we mainly produced television programs and videos. However, since 2021, we have entered the absorbent shorts business. The fields are completely different, but we essentially run both businesses.
The focus on absorbent shorts began during an interview with sports athletes. From the Olympic athletes we interviewed, we learned that menstruating during the Olympics was a stressful experience.
